WebThe molecular formula C5H4O (molar mass: 80.08 g/mol, exact mass: 80.0262 u) may refer to: Cyclopentadienone. 1,4-Pentadiyn-3-ol [Wikidata] 2,4-Pentadiyn-1-ol [Wikidata] This set index page lists chemical structure articles associated with the same molecular formula. WebIn chemistry, pi bonds (π bonds) are covalent chemical bonds, in each of which two lobes of an orbital on one atom overlap with two lobes of an orbital on another atom, and in which this overlap occurs laterally. When drawing the structure of a neutral organic compound, you will find it helpful to remember that. each carbon atom has four bonds. each nitrogen atom has three bonds. each oxygen atom has two bonds. each hydrogen atom has one bond.
